Deploy step 4 — SquatSentry scanner rollout. After the image builds, the scanner pulls the package-name corpus from the Namegraph feed at boot, so first startup takes a few minutes; that's expected. Confirm the feed version in the logs matches the one announced at sync. Config is read from /etc/squatsentry/.env on each worker. Before restarting the service, add the Namegraph feed credential to that file on the line right after this sentence.

secret setting of yagef-baweg: RELAY_SECRET29=cb53deb59a49ed54d9f43599b54ca

Ticket: Staging env misconfigured for Siftgate bloom filter

The bloom layer in front of the Pellet KV store is rejecting all lookups in staging because the env file was copied from the dev template without credentials. False-positive tuning values are fine; only the auth line is missing. To unblock the weekly demo, the Pellet admission secret must be set on the following line.

env line for yaguf-fajop: LEDGER_TOKEN13=fb08984397349

## Authentication

Heads up: the nightly reindex job (`reindex_nightly.py`) talks to the Lanternfish search cluster, and that cluster won't accept anonymous writes anymore — we locked it down last sprint. The job now authenticates as the `reindex-runner` service identity against Corvid Gateway, and the token is injected via the `LF_INDEX_TOKEN` env var in the scheduler config. Nothing clever going on, just a bearer header on every batch request. For review purposes, the staging credential currently in use is listed below.

service key, kadug-kadup: kto15_rN23XLAYImmZgrJ